【校对MySQL,朝双赢大道迈进】(mysql校对集)
千百年来,一路熠熠生辉,MySQL仍然继续被用作网站程序的数据存储引擎,如今褪去的锐气更多的是稳当的耐用。这也让程序开发者以及系统架构者有机会在MySQL上开展持久的安全校对,以保证数据可靠准确。
MySQL的校对分为两个部分:系统层的校对和SQL语句层的校对。
系统层的校对主要是指确保MySQL服务器的性能。所谓确保MySQL服务器性能,其实就是考虑MySQL服务器的可用内存,索引结构,允许的最大连接数,最大查询时长以及客户端访问优化等,都要优化到今日最佳性能来。可以在MySQL客户端执行这些校对动作,也可以使用调优助手,比如使用更多 MySQL工具集包含的工具,如MySQLTuner,针对服务器内存,查询时间,连接数等提供调优建议,以便于管理和使用MySQL服务器时更加 高效。
SQL语句层的校对指的是要及时修复SQL语句中的错误以及确保这些SQL语句能够最大化利用索引,进而提高性能。在确定数据方案时要结合实际情况,选用合适的索引类型,因为不同的索引可以更加精确的满足应用场景的数据检索需求。同时,根据应用场景,也需要检查SQL语句的复杂度以及是否存在不必要的 JOIN 操作, 尽可能地减少查询的复杂度,有利于改善系统的全局性能。
要想稳扎稳打,MySQL的安全校对也非常重要。可以先利用MySQL工具箱中的安全校对工具,对MySQL进行授权、权限、密码强度、慢查询及SQL注入等安全校对,再把必要的MySQL访问权限限制在内网中,最后就可以保证MySQL的安全提供良好的上线环境。
校对MySQL,必将助力朝双赢大道迈进,把MySQL服务器既运行更安全,又能发挥出性能的最大值,实现有效的数据采集、处理及分析,为系统的健康运行保驾护航。